Since debuting the Serie M in 2021, Cohiba has used the annual release as a platform to spotlight small-batch craftsmanship, partnering with El Titan de Bronze in Miami’s Little Havana for each installment. The 2025 edition, Serie M Reserva Azul, marks the fifth release in the series and the second year in which the brand has opted for a fully new blend rather than a simple size adjustment. Rolled exclusively in a 6″ x 52 toro, the cigar features a Dominican Corojo wrapper over a Nicaraguan binder from Estelí, with fillers of Nicaraguan viso and ligero from Jalapa and Estelí alongside Dominican Piloto Cubano. It is also the first Serie M to use a Dominican wrapper, setting it apart from its predecessors visually and in character, with a blue-accented band reflecting the Azul (Spanish for Blue) name. On the palate, the profile leans medium-bodied and structured, with a deliberate character that highlights the skill of El Titan de Bronze’s torcedores. The Azul opens with fresh cedar and cabinet spice before settling into roasted nuts, light earth, and toasted bread on the back end. A creamy undertone carries through the middle portion, helping soften the sharper edges and keeping the experience balanced from start to finish.

Cohiba Serie M Reserva Azul Breakdown

  • Wrapper: Dominican Corojo
  • Binder: Nicaragua (Estelí)
  • Filler: Nicaragua (Jalapa | Estelí) | Dominican Republic (Piloto Cubano)
  • Factory: El Titan de Bronze (USA)
  • Production: Limited Edition (30,000 Cigars)
  • Vitolas: 1 (6″ x 52 Toro)
  • Price: $29.99 (MSRP)
